Overview of Microsoft Azure and its capabilities

Microsoft Azure is a cloud computing platform and service provided by Microsoft. It offers a wide range of cloud services, including computing power, storage, and networking capabilities. Azure provides a secure and reliable environment for hosting enterprise applications, allowing businesses to scale their infrastructure as needed.

With Azure, businesses can take advantage of various capabilities such as virtual machines, databases, AI services, and IoT solutions. The platform also offers extensive support for different programming languages and frameworks, making it flexible and accessible for developers.

By migrating enterprise applications to Microsoft Azure, businesses can benefit from its high availability, scalability, and global reach. Azure data centers are located in various regions around the world, ensuring that applications can deliver optimal performance to users regardless of their location.

Moreover, Azure provides advanced security features and compliance certifications, giving businesses peace of mind when it comes to protecting their data. With Azure's robust disaster recovery and backup solutions, businesses can ensure the continuity of their operations even in the face of unexpected events.

Benefits of migrating enterprise applications to Microsoft Azure

Migrating enterprise applications to Microsoft Azure offers numerous benefits for businesses:

  • Scalability: Azure allows businesses to easily scale their applications up or down based on demand. This flexibility ensures that businesses can meet the needs of their users without investing in costly infrastructure.
  • Cost savings: By leveraging Azure's pay-as-you-go pricing model, businesses can optimize their costs by only paying for the resources they actually use. This eliminates the need for upfront investments in hardware and allows for more efficient resource allocation.
  • Improved performance: Azure's global infrastructure and content delivery network (CDN) enable businesses to deliver their applications with low latency and high performance to users around the world.
  • Enhanced security: Azure provides robust security measures to protect data and applications from threats. With features like encryption, identity management, and threat detection, businesses can ensure the confidentiality and integrity of their sensitive information.
  • Advanced analytics and AI capabilities: Azure offers a range of AI and analytics services that businesses can leverage to gain valuable insights from their data. This enables data-driven decision-making and empowers businesses to drive innovation and improve their operations.
  • Seamless integration with existing systems: Azure provides seamless integration with on-premises systems and other cloud services, allowing businesses to leverage their existing investments and infrastructure.
  • Simplified management and maintenance: Azure's management tools and automation capabilities make it easier for businesses to manage and maintain their applications. This frees up resources and allows IT teams to focus on more strategic initiatives.

Best practices for migrating enterprise applications to Microsoft Azure

To ensure a successful migration of enterprise applications to Microsoft Azure, businesses should consider the following best practices:

  • Planning and assessment: Conduct a thorough assessment of your current applications and infrastructure to identify dependencies, performance requirements, and potential challenges. Create a migration plan that outlines the necessary steps and timelines.
  • Prioritization: Prioritize applications based on their criticality and complexity. Start with smaller, less critical applications to gain experience and refine the migration process before tackling larger, mission-critical applications.
  • Data migration: Develop a data migration strategy to ensure a smooth transition of data to Azure. Consider factors such as data volume, security, and data consistency during the migration process.
  • Testing and validation: Test the migrated applications in Azure to ensure that they function properly and meet performance expectations. Conduct thorough validation and testing before fully transitioning to Azure.
  • Monitoring and optimization: Implement monitoring and optimization tools to track the performance and usage of your applications in Azure. Continuously optimize your resources to ensure cost-efficiency and optimal performance.
  • Training and support: Provide training and support to your IT teams to familiarize them with Azure's tools and capabilities. This will facilitate a smooth transition and enable them to effectively manage and maintain the migrated applications.
